What Exactly Is a Tek Screw Manufacturer?

Simply put, a tek screw manufacturer designs and produces specialized fasteners known as tek screws. These screws self-drill through materials like metal or timber, eliminating the need for separate drilling steps. The “tek” part actually comes from “technical,” emphasizing their engineered design.

Core Attributes that Define Quality Tek Screws

1. Durability

Any tek screw manufacturer worth their salt knows durability is king. These screws often face harsh environmental conditions — think moisture, rust, or vibration. High-grade steel with corrosion-resistant coatings is the norm.

2. Precision Engineering

The drill tip and threading must be perfectly shaped to prevent material damage and ensure a clean, tight bond. Precision here translates into less wasted time and fewer onsite headaches.

3. Versatility

Many tek screws are designed for a variety of substrates — steel, aluminum, wood. Manufacturers often offer a range of sizes and coatings, making customization easier.

4. Cost Efficiency

By integrating drilling and fastening into one action, these screws help reduce labor costs and tooling expenses.

5. Scalability

Major tek screw manufacturers handle large orders that support everything from local projects to international construction efforts, ensuring consistency across batches.

Global Impacts and Real-World Applications

You’ll find tek screws almost everywhere metal structures are involved. For instance:

  • Post-disaster rebuilding: NGOs assembling quick shelters rely on self-drilling screws to speed up construction without heavy equipment.
  • Remote industrial projects: Mining or oil rigs in isolated locations use tek screws to reduce the need for bulky setup tools.
  • Light commercial buildings: In rapidly urbanizing countries, prefab steel frames joined with tek screws allow for faster construction cycles.
  • Renewable energy: Solar panel mounts, needing robust but lightweight connectors, often use tek screws crafted by specialized manufacturers.

Product Specification Table: Typical Tek Screw Range

Feature Specification
Material High tensile carbon steel (grade 8.8 or 10.9)
Coating Options Zinc-plated, galvanic, epoxy resin coatings
Diameter Range 4 mm to 10 mm
Length Range 12 mm to 100 mm
Head Type Hex washer, pan, countersunk
Thread Type Coarse, fine, multi-start threads

Frequently Asked Questions About Tek Screw Manufacturers

Q1: How do tek screws differ from standard screws?

A1: Tek screws are unique in that they include a drill bit tip, allowing them to cut through metal or wood without pre-drilling. This means faster installation and reduced tool requirements compared to standard screws.

Q2: Can tek screws be used in outdoor environments?

A2: Absolutely. Most tek screws made by reputable manufacturers come with coatings like zinc plating or galvanization to resist corrosion, making them suitable for outdoor or harsh environments.

Q3: How does a tek screw manufacturer ensure product quality?

A3: Leading manufacturers implement strict quality control protocols including ISO 9001 certification, consistent material testing, and batch inspections to maintain durability and performance.

Q4: Is it possible to order custom sizes or coatings?

A4: Yes, many tek screw manufacturers offer customization depending on project needs — whether it’s longer screws, specific thread types, or specialized coatings for environmental concerns.

Q5: What industries benefit most from tek screws?

A5: Construction, manufacturing, renewable energy installations, and emergency housing sectors are primary beneficiaries. The fastening speed and reliability especially help in rapid build environments.
